博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
编译安装PHP7并安装Redis扩展Swoole扩展
阅读量:6298 次
发布时间:2019-06-22

本文共 1784 字,大约阅读时间需要 5 分钟。

hot3.png

编译安装PHP7并安装Redis扩展Swoole扩展

在编译php7的机器上已经有编译安装过php5.3以上的版本,从而依赖库都有了

本php7是编译成fpm-php 使用的,

如果是apache那么编译参数应该为

--with-apxs2=/usr/local/apache/bin/apxs

编译安装php7

wget -c http://www.php.net/distributions/php-7.0.0.tar.gztar zxvf php-7.0.0.tar.gzcd php-7.0.0./configure \--prefix=/usr/local/php7 \--with-config-file-path=/usr/local/php7/etc \--enable-fpm \--with-fpm-user=www \--with-fpm-group=www \--with-mysqli=mysqlnd \--with-pdo-mysql=mysqlnd \--with-iconv-dir \--with-freetype-dir=/usr/local/freetype \--with-jpeg-dir -\-with-png-dir \--with-zlib \--with-libxml-dir=/usr \--enable-xml \--disable-rpath \--enable-bcmath \--enable-shmop \--enable-sysvsem \--enable-inline-optimization \--with-curl \--enable-mbregex \--enable-mbstring \--with-mcrypt \--enable-ftp \--with-gd \--enable-gd-native-ttf \--with-openssl \--with-mhash \--enable-pcntl \--enable-sockets \--with-xmlrpc \--enable-zip \--enable-soap \--with-gettext \--disable-fileinfo \--enable-opcachemake ZEND_EXTRA_LIBS='-liconv'make installcp php.ini-production /usr/local/php7/etc/php.inicd ..

编译安装php7的redis扩展支持

wget -c https://github.com/phpredis/phpredis/archive/php7.zipunzip php7.zipcd phpredis-php7/usr/local/php7/bin/phpize./configure --with-php-config=/usr/local/php7/bin/php-configmakemake installcd ..

/usr/local/php7/etc/php.ini

中加入
extension=redis.so

编译安装php7的swoole

wget -c https://github.com/swoole/swoole-src/archive/swoole-1.7.21-stable.tar.gztar zxvf swoole-1.7.21-stable.tar.gzcd swoole-src-swoole-1.7.21-stable//usr/local/php7/bin/phpize./configure --with-php-config=/usr/local/php7/bin/php-configmakemake installcd ..

/usr/local/php7/etc/php.ini

中加入
extension=swoole.so

参考:

http://www.iamle.com/archives/1989.html

http://www.yiibai.com/redis/redis_php.html

转载于:https://my.oschina.net/u/1260221/blog/615300

你可能感兴趣的文章
10款最好的免费在线工具进行网站设计与开发
查看>>
测试jsp
查看>>
git
查看>>
寻找水王
查看>>
ExtJs4 笔记(5) Ext.Button 按钮
查看>>
适合自己的vim配置文件
查看>>
探秘Tomcat——连接篇
查看>>
Python——拼接字符串
查看>>
微信小程序图片变形解决方法
查看>>
MFC菜鸟学编程——第一篇
查看>>
甘超波:目标和目的区别
查看>>
Djando 的 cmd命令
查看>>
《微服务设计》读书笔记
查看>>
iOS8 tableview separatorInset cell分割线左对齐,ios7的方法失效了
查看>>
微信小程序----日期时间选择器(自定义精确到分秒或时段)
查看>>
【转】.NET正则基础之——正则委托
查看>>
web-inf下文件访问
查看>>
项目经验分享——Java常用工具类集合 转
查看>>
What should we do when meet a crash in android?
查看>>
分享一些平时测试用的sql payloads
查看>>